On Wed, Feb 07, 2001 at 08:59:25AM +0100, Christoph Plattner wrote:
> I was definitly not able to build strace with the current tool chain
> (I have built myself from Jan 13, 2001). The system calls and other
> parts seem not to be compatible any more....

I've removed the hack that made it work with old glibc that didn't
provide a sys_ptrace wrapper, so it should now be ok with a newer
toolchain.  So, if you could try again and let me know...
